Q: Is 13,211,350 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 13,211,350 is not a prime number.

Why is 13,211,350 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 13211350 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 131 262 655 1,310 2,017 3,275 4,034 6,550 10,085 20,170 50,425 100,850 264,227 528,454 1,321,135 2,642,270 6,605,675 and 13,211,350, with no remainder.

Since 13,211,350 cannot be divided by just 1 and 13,211,350, it is not a prime number.
